With the rapid development of e-business, web applications based on the Web are developed from localization to globalization, from B2C (business-to-customer) to B2B(business-to-business), from centralized fashion to decentralized fashion. Composing existing services on Internet to obtain new functionality becomes essential and is conductive to enterprise's efficient application. Web composite service is important and necessary to carry out the research on the new architecture of web services, on the combinations with other good techniques, and on the integration of services.At first, this paper has introduced related technologies on services selection and discovery. Then the paper has proposed a new strategy on composite selection based on composability between basic services in composite service. During the process of selecting optimal composite service, it has converted the traditional complex QoS solution model to a 0-1 based on linear programming model by adding a virtual basic service with its all QoS effect being 1 into candidate service sets corresponding to task in composite service. The new objective function is the optimization problem on QoS of composite serveice, and it's linear to 0-1 variables. These variables mark the state whether coprresponding service is selected. Constraints contain two aspects, users'expectation on QoS and composability between basic services. In the course of problem solving, the conduct of filtering composite service has used advanced implicit enumeration algorithm, which makes solving speed much faster by adding an appropriate constraint. At last, a lot of simulation experiments are done on computer system. The experiment results show that the composite service algorithm proposed by this paper is workable.
